ATF agent shot in Athens; suspect killed

ATHENS - An agent with the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co Firearms and Explosives (ATF) was shot during an undercover investigation near the Athens-Ben Epps Airport Tuesday afternoon.<br /> <br /> ATF spokeswoman Ginger Colbrun said the agent - whose name has not been made public - was in stable condition following the shooting. <br /> <br /> The Georgia Bureau of Investigation said the agent was fired on during the undercover operation. He returned fire, killing one suspect.<br /> <br /> CBS46 in Atlanta identified the suspect as 20-year-old Javontay Darden. The television station reported a second suspect, 21-year-old Steven McKinley, was arrested. <br /> <br /> The agent is being treated at Athens Regional Medical Center.<br /> <br /> Both the GBI and the ATF continue to piece together details of the incident.<br /> <br /> <i>The Associated Press contributed to this story.</i>
